Manchester Airports Group Data Breach: No Hacking Required
The Manchester Airports Group data breach underscores vital lessons in API security and data protection.
On August 27, 2026, Manchester Airports Group informed customers of a data breach affecting approximately 8.8 million individuals. The group FulcrumSec claimed they did not hack but simply read an API key from the website's JavaScript. This incident highlights crucial lessons for engineers regarding API security and data protection practices.
